Replacing your windows involves a few variables that change the final bill. The biggest factor is the frame material,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, which all carry different price points. You also have to consider the glass package—like double versus triple pane—and whether you need specialized coatings for energy efficiency. The complexity of the installation matters, too; if your openings are non-standard or require structural repairs, labor costs will climb.
